Как получить имена атрибутов таблицы? - PullRequest
0 голосов
/ 18 августа 2010

Я работаю Sql Server 2005 Моя таблица называется Customer, атрибуты

Orderid Customerid Customeraddress

, где Customerid - это первичный ключ, а Orderid - внешний ключ.1006 * Я хочу знать имя первичного ключа, имя внешнего ключа и имя таблицы, в которой внешний ключ существует в качестве первичного ключа

Существует ли какой-либо запрос для получения этих имен с использованием имени таблицы?Пожалуйста, предоставьте мне вопросы ... Заранее спасибо

1 Ответ

0 голосов
/ 18 августа 2010

- список всех столбцов в таблице BLAH выберите имя из sys.columns c, sys.tables t где c.object_id = t.object_id и t.name = 'BLAH'

...